Cyanotype style, blue, printable Christmas cards with funny Christmas card messages inside. Fronts say: Thank you, Happy New Year, Buon Natale (Italian), Feliz Navidad (Spanish), Frohe weihnachten (German), Joyeux Noël (French), God Jul (Swedish/Nordic), Wesolych Swiat (Polish), Nollaig Chridheil agus Bliadhna Mhath Ùr (Scottish Gaelic), Fa La La. The insides are quirky, multilingual messages. These unique holiday cards with a humorous twist add a touch of cosmopolitan flair for international or sophisticated friends and family. NB: Cyanotype prints are blue but you can get a Creepmas or Spooky Christmas aesthetic by printing these with black ink. The example photos show black ink on blue card. What you will receive: - a PDF guide with a link to my Google drive folder - 10 variations on the front of the card with wording in different languages, including a thank you card in one PDF file, you can choose which pages to print. - variations on quirky inside messages in English, Spanish (tbc), German, French, Swedish, Polish, Italian, Scottish Gaelic - the backs of the cards there’s options for charity donation via QR code links (a new twist on charity cards) - Canva editable version, say exactly what you want to say or edit the charity QR codes This card is designed to be printed on US Letter size paper or A4 (making A5 sized cards).
